The Winning Helix

 

By Cristina Anderson

 

 

In business as in life, winning isn’t a matter of life or death, it is far more important than that. Most business fail because its leadership and management play not to lose, rather than to win. Winning doesn’t mean trampling over the bodies of your opposition, rather it means developing, preparing and manifesting an attitude to achieve your true potential. Winning is a combination of an art and a science. The art is developing the proper mental attitude; the science is developing the learning skills that are so essential to manifesting the winning attitude and making it part of your DNA.

 

Cristina Andersson in her book The Winning Helix takes you on a journey of discovery of defining the DNA of a winning attitude, the science of an action-learning process and how to mobilize the energy to apply these techniques to achieve your objective. As one reader commented “Winning is an episode of learning. An episode , where with the help of difficulties and obstacles and after a physical, spiritual or social struggle a person manages to surpass their limits.” To be a winner in life and/or business one has to constantly train as any championship athlete. The Winning Helix is the training manual that lays out the roadmap to winning at everything to which you aspire.

 

As the book takes you though the winning process you become intimately involved with the author as she allows you to overhear the conversations she had with her coach and mentor Collin Hansen as she developed into a professional operatic singer that has entertained heads of state. The techniques described are so efficiently presented that Silver Fox Venture Partners makes the book required reading for anyone before we invest in them.
